Output 65ca5f1306f09d172aa77e1dd16e114e868f6c5a5b9eb1b79b4463db2bb6bc2e:53

value
111060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ec3ed34690d55e048546cafa5369071ff1924ad3 OP_EQUAL
address
3PEAezbNACWN2CuiFEZ9EgyH64AAeXGy5P
transaction
65ca5f1306f09d172aa77e1dd16e114e868f6c5a5b9eb1b79b4463db2bb6bc2e
confirmations
266297
spent
true